Whats about DLSS
DLSS or FSR can reduce flickering of textures, improve image stability and reduce energy consumption of your GPU (so said saving money while playing the game).
90% of gaming rigs out there is capable of supporting those technologies.
Even a SteamDeck could do the magic.

Why is SCS not able to implement this?

SCS have always played the long term game with their titles. They never implement shinny new tech which invariably gets adapted and changed in later iterations. Glad to see the TAA is no longer required from Nvidia DLSS.

All this tech keeps changing and adapting. After five or so years it is starting to not only mature but it is getting the the point of being almost universally good with far less negative points.

AS both SCS trucking games have DX12 and vulkan support in the pipeline, then it makes sense as a developer to make this work well before adding other features as you then don't have to keep patching for finicky up-scaling tech that is easily broken.

Many developers want to see where this tech goes before getting directly involved.
